#1b8944 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1b8944 is composed of 10.6% red, 53.7%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 50.4%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 142.4 degrees, a saturation of 67.1% and a lightness of 32.2%. #1b8944 color hex could be obtained by blending #36ff88 with #001300.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

Shades and Tints of #1b8944
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010603 is the darkest color, while #f5fd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#1b8944
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4d5751 is the less saturated color, while #02a23e is the most saturated one.
